FS: GMPP Extrude Honed Exhaust Manifold
I replaced my GMPP extrude honed LSJ manifold with a header awhile back, sandblasted it at my dad's shop, and gave it a quick coat of 1200° high temp black paint. I have all the studs and nuts for the collector end but if I were putting it back in a car of my own I would use new stuff; you can find the studs & nuts at CED but its about $20 worth of hardware.
My estimate is approximately 4000 miles on the manifold.
